Bucknell Women's Rowing Sweeps Five Home Races from MIT, Robert Morris
April 5, 2009
![]() SHAMOKIN DAM, Pa. (Susquehanna River) - The Bucknell women's rowing team, which was picked first in the recent Patriot League Preseason Poll, competed at home on the Susquehanna River for the only time this year on Sunday morning and swept five races from MIT and Robert Morris. The Bison defeated MIT in each of the three eights races, while they won over Robert Morris in both the varsity four and second varsity four. Bucknell started out the day with its varsity eight and second varsity eight finishing one-two. MIT's varsity eight came in third in that race. The Bison novice eight and lightweight eight followed with a one-two finish against MIT's second varsity eight. Bucknell continued its success with wins over Robert Morris in the varsity four and second varsity four. The varsity four race was the closest race of the day as the Bison won by just 1.01 seconds over the Colonials. The second varsity four was a different story as Bucknell won by more than 16 seconds. The final race of the morning was the novice eight and Bucknell completed its sweep with a 2.52-second victory. Each of the rowers in this race had already rowed in an earlier race. The Bison will be back in action on the road next Saturday, April 11, when they travel to Lake Carnegie to face Princeton, Cornell and Radcliffe.
